Kevin Brodsky <kevin.brodsky@linaro.org> |
Optimizing: ARM64 negated bitwise operations simplification Use negated instructions on ARM64 to replace [bitwise operation + not] patterns, that is: a & ~b (BIC) a | ~b (ORN) a ^ ~b (EON) The simplification only happens if the Not is only used by the bitwise operation. It does not happen if both inputs are Not's (this should be handled by a generic simplification applying De Morgan's laws). Change-Id: I0e112b23fd8b8e10f09bfeff5994508a8ff96e9c

Alexandre Rames <alexandre.rames@linaro.org> |
ARM64: Use the shifter operands. This introduces architecture-specific instruction simplification. On ARM64 we try to merge shifts and sign-extension operations into arithmetic and logical instructions. For example for the Java code int res = a + (b << 5); we would generate lsl w3, w2, #5 add w0, w1, w3 and we now generate add w0, w1, w2, lsl #5 Change-Id: Ic03bdff44a1c12e21ddff1b0513bd32a730742b7

Alexandre Rames <alexandre.rames@linaro.org> |
ARM64: Instruction simplification for array accesses. HArrayGet and HArraySet with variable indexes generate two instructions on arm64, like add temp, obj, #data_offset ldr out, [temp, index LSL #shift_amount] When we have multiple accesses to the same array, the initial `add` instruction is redundant. This patch introduces the first instruction simplification in the arm64-specific instruction simplification pass. It splits HArrayGet and HArraySet using the new arm64-specific IR HIntermediateAddress. After that we run GVN again to squash the multiple occurrences of HIntermediateAddress.
